Dorothy Hueber of Warminster died peacefully on Monday, February 13, 2017 at The Birches of Newtown surrounded by her family. She was 88 years old.

She was the beloved wife of the late William J. Hueber for 49 years.

Born in Staten Island, she was the daughter of the late James A. and Dorothy M. Mann Corey, and sister of the late Gerard and James Corey, and Joan McIntyre.

Dorothy retired from the Centennial School District, and was an active member, in many different capacities, of Nativity of Our Lord Parish in Warminster. She loved bowling and trips to the beach, but above all she loved spending time with her children, grandchildren, and extended family members.

Dorothy is survived by her loving children and their spouses, William and Pam Hueber, Dorothy and Don Bourlier, Bernadette and William Doughterty, Mary and Mark Young, Robert and Liz Hueber and James Hueber. She will be greatly missed by her 16 grandchildren and 9 great grandchildren. She is also survived by her sister and brother-in-law Bernadette and Harry Klumbach.

Relatives and friends are invited to gather on Friday, February 17 from 9:00am until Dorothy’s Funeral Mass, 11:00am at Nativity of Our Lord Church, 605 W. Street Rd, Warminster, PA 18974. Burial will follow at St. John Neumann Cemetery in Chalfont, PA.

In lieu of flowers, contributions may be made in Dorothy’s memory to the A.J. Foundation for Autism PO Box 234, Wycombe, PA 18980.
